目录

  • Jeecg-Boot项目简介
  • 源码下载
  • 升级日志
  • Issues解决
  • v1.1升级到v2.0不兼容地方
  • 系统截图

Jeecg-Boot项目简介

Jeecg-boot 是一款基于代码生成器的智能开发平台!采用前后端分离技术:SpringBoot,Mybatis,Shiro,JWT,Vue & Ant Design。提供强大的代码生成器, 前端页面和后台代码一键生成,不需要写任何代码,保持jeecg一贯的强大,绝对是全栈开发者福音!! JeecgBoot的宗旨是降低前后端分离的开发成本,提高UI能力的同时提高开发效率,追求更高的能力,No代码概念,一系列智能化在线开发。

源码下载

升级日志

本版本JAVA后台项目拆分成maven多模块module模式,前端UI封装各种组件和报表控件,增加很多高级功能示例:

  • java项目结构重构,采用maven多模块module构建
  • 数据库兼容专项改造工作,支持mysql、oracle、SqlServer提供了对应脚步
  • 表单权限实现(可控制字段隐藏、字段禁用)
  • 数据权限完善(实现组织机构自动注入逻辑、用户拥有多部门采用选择部门登录机制 等等)
  • 完善加强行编辑表格控件 JEditableTable
  • 完善导出导入逻辑,采用shiro权限控制,解决获取不到登录人问题
  • 封装JTreeTable组件,异步加载树列表
  • 完善打印组件,支持canvas报表自适应打印
  • 登陆增加验证码
  • 封装共通组件:用户选择控件、部门选择组件、选择多用户排序组件等
  • 消息模板支持富文本编辑器
  • 添加菜单默认路由类型,智能补数据功能的bug修复
  • 字典标签支持disabled属性、支持radio类型
  • 监控页面重构
  • 新增磁盘监控功能
  • 新增在线pdf预览功能
  • 新增分屏功能
  • 解决用户管理新增上传图片无法修改图片的问题
  • 代码生成器模板功能完善,追加注解自动生成swaagerUI接口文档
  • 集成boostrap风格swaggerUI在线文档
  • 重构在线定时任务,启动bug解决
  • springboot版本升级2.1.3
  • 重构获取用户菜单和权限方法,通过token获取,接口更安全
  • online导入导出(一对多)完善
  • 类注释不规范修改
  • 升级autopoi版本,解决发布后导入路径问题
  • 新增我的部门管理功能
  • 首页菜单优化,支持单独滚动,上方菜单模式支持IE
  • 图片预览插件
  • 图片翻页功能
  • 图片拖拽排序示例
  • 常用组件各种封装和示例代码
  • 多选checkbox组件封装
  • 提供数据快照功能,记录单据每次变更内容
  • 图形报表封装组件完善,提供对应的示例和文档
  • 封装JCodeEditor组件,在线编码编辑器
  • 封装下拉多选组件览区域中间;

Issues解决

v1.1升级到v2.0不兼容地方

1.混入js更名

src/mixins/JEditableTableOneToManyMixin.js --rename–> JEditableTableMixin.js

修改方案: 全文搜索JEditableTableOneToManyMixin替换为JEditableTableMixin

2.excel导入逻辑

需要设置headers参数,因为导入导出都加了shiro控制

给<a-upload 标签加上 :headers=“tokenHeader”

3.excel导出逻辑,需要制定导出文件名字

handleExportXls(‘导出excel名字’)

4.样式冲突问题

全文搜索ant-layout-content删除下面一段代码

.ant-layout-content {
    margin: 12px 16px 0 !important;
    }

5.所有页面样式没有scoped的加上

系统截图

            

​​​​​

Jeecg-Boot 2.0 版本发布,基于Springboot+Vue 前后端分离快速开发平台的更多相关文章

  1. Jeecg-Boot 2.0.1 版本发布,前后端分离快速开发平台

    Jeecg-Boot项目简介 Jeecg-boot 是一款基于代码生成器的快速开发平台! 采用前后端分离技术:SpringBoot,Mybatis,Shiro,JWT,Vue & Ant De ...

  2. SpringBoot+Vue前后端分离,使用SpringSecurity完美处理权限问题

    原文链接:https://segmentfault.com/a/1190000012879279 当前后端分离时,权限问题的处理也和我们传统的处理方式有一点差异.笔者前几天刚好在负责一个项目的权限管理 ...

  3. Springboot+vue前后端分离项目,poi导出excel提供用户下载的解决方案

    因为我们做的是前后端分离项目 无法采用response.write直接将文件流写出 我们采用阿里云oss 进行保存 再返回的结果对象里面保存我们的文件地址 废话不多说,上代码 Springboot 第 ...

  4. SpringBoot,Vue前后端分离开发首秀

    需求:读取数据库的数据展现到前端页面 技术栈:后端有主要有SpringBoot,lombok,SpringData JPA,Swagger,跨域,前端有Vue和axios 不了解这些技术的可以去入门一 ...

  5. SpringBoot+Vue前后端分离项目,maven package自动打包整合

    起因:看过Dubbo管控台的都知道,人家是个前后端分离的项目,可是一条打包命令能让两个项目整合在一起,我早想这样玩玩了. 1. 建立个maven父项目 next 这个作为父工程,next Finish ...

  6. SpringBoot +Vue 前后端分离实例

    今天下了Vue,想试一试前后端分离的实现,没想到坑还不少,这里就记录一下我遇到的坑和我的代码: 一.Vue的下载安装:从网上找就好了,没什么问题,除了下载以后,要把镜像库改成淘宝的,要不然太慢了. 二 ...

  7. springboot+vue前后端分离,nginx代理配置 tomcat 部署war包详细配置

    1.做一个小系统,使用了springboot+vue 基础框架参考这哥们的,直接拿过来用,链接https://github.com/smallsnail-wh/interest 前期的开发环境搭建就不 ...

  8. SpringBoot+Vue前后端分离,使用SpringSecurity完美处理权限问题(一)

    当前后端分离时,权限问题的处理也和我们传统的处理方式有一点差异. 笔者前几天刚好在负责一个项目的权限管理模块,现在权限管理模块已经做完了,我想通过5-6篇文章,来介绍一下项目中遇到的问题以及我的解决方 ...

  9. SpringBoot + Vue前后端分离图片上传到本地并前端访问图片

    同理应该可用于其他文件 图片上传 application.yml 配置相关常量 prop: upload-folder: E:/test/ # 配置SpringMVC文件上传限制,默认1M.注意MB要 ...

随机推荐

  1. 最短路(模板Dtra

    #include<iostream> #include<cstdio> #include<cstring> using namespace std; const i ...

  2. LeetCode 31. Next Permutation【Medium】

    Implement next permutation, which rearranges numbers into the lexicographically next greater permuta ...

  3. springboot整合thymeleaf手动渲染

    Thymeleaf手动渲染 为提高页面访问速度,可缓存html页面,客户端请求从缓存获取,获取不到再手动渲染 在spring4下 @Autowired ThymeleafViewResolver th ...

  4. java——有1、2、3、4个数字,能组成多少个互不相同且无重复数字的三位数?都是多少?

    package java_day10; /* * 有1.2.3.4个数字,能组成多少个互不相同且无重复数字的三位数?都是多少? */ public class Demo04 { public stat ...

  5. android的webView内部https/http混合以及自适应屏幕

    两种请求都有的情况下,会导致WebView加载不出来. //自适应屏幕 settings.setUseWideViewPort(true); settings.setLoadWithOverviewM ...

  6. 《构建之法》CH5~6读书笔记 PB16110698 第九周(~5.15)

    这段时间我阅读了<构建之法>的大部分章节,包括个人技能.软件测试.用户体验和需求分析等相关内容.之前的个人作业和结对作业结束后,我们的工作重心终于转向了团队项目,作为团队中前端组的组长,我 ...

  7. VBA中msgbox的用法小结

    1.作用在消息框中显示信息,并等待用户单击按钮,可返回单击的按钮值(比如“确定”或者“取消”).通常用作显示变量值的一种方式.2.语法MsgBox(Prompt[,Buttons][,Title][, ...

  8. linux 服务器安装php5.6

    查看原有的php版本:php -v 如果已经装了低版本的php,为了避免冲突,查看: yum list installed | grep php 删除:自行百度吧.可能不能一次性全部删除,只能一个一个 ...

  9. MySQL - 锁等待超时与information_schema的三个表

    引用地址:https://blog.csdn.net/J080624/article/details/80596958 回顾一下生产中的一次MySQL异常,Cause: java.sql.SQLExc ...

  10. Python学习笔记(六)——类和对象

    1.self的用法 全面理解self 2. 继承 子类继承父类,自动拥有父类的全部方法 >>> class Animal: def run(self): print('Animal ...